Introduction à Chaindoc
Chaindoc est une solution blockchain pour les signatures électroniques et la gestion documentaire. Vous obtenez des signatures électroniques juridiquement contraignantes, une vérification immuable et une API complète pour construire vos propres intégrations.
Qu'est-ce que Chaindoc ?
Chaindoc gère trois aspects essentiels : les documents, les signatures et la collaboration en équipe. Chaque document que vous publiez est vérifié sur un réseau blockchain, ce qui signifie que personne ne peut le falsifier par la suite. C'est précisément ce que la plupart des outils de signature omettent.
Cette solution s'adresse aux développeurs souhaitant intégrer la signature dans leurs propres applications, mais elle fonctionne aussi immédiatement via l'interface web. Vous n'avez pas besoin d'écrire de code pour envoyer votre première demande de signature.
Ce que vous pouvez faire avec Chaindoc
Vérification blockchain
Chaque document publié reçoit automatiquement un hash écrit sur un réseau blockchain. Vous n'avez rien à configurer. La vérification fonctionne sur Ethereum, Polygon, BSC et Arbitrum, vous permettant de choisir la chaîne qui correspond à vos besoins en termes de coût et de rapidité.
Signatures électroniques
Chaindoc prend en charge les signatures simples, avancées et qualifiées conformes au eIDAS, au ESIGN Act et à l'UETA. Vous pouvez configurer des workflows de signature multi-parties avec ordres de signature séquentiels ou parallèles, échéances et rappels automatiques.
Voici la réalité : la plupart des équipes n'ont pas besoin de signatures qualifiées. Les signatures électroniques simples couvrent 90% des contrats commerciaux. Consultez la documentation sur les signatures pour déterminer quel type correspond à votre cas d'usage.
Gestion documentaire
- Contrôle de version avec historique complet d'audit pour chaque modification
- Téléchargements de fichiers PDF, Office, images et vidéos
- Contrôle d'accès : privé, public, équipe ou restreint
- Métadonnées, hashtags et recherche plein texte pour trouver rapidement vos documents
Si vous venez d'un lecteur réseau partagé ou d'un stockage de fichiers basique, la principale différence réside dans l'historique d'audit. Chaque consultation, modification et signature est enregistrée. Vous pouvez en apprendre plus sur le fonctionnement dans le guide de gestion documentaire.
Outils pour développeurs
Chaindoc dispose d'une REST API et de SDKs TypeScript pour le backend (Node.js) et le frontend (React, Vue, Angular). Vous pouvez également intégrer le composant de signature embarqué, permettant à vos utilisateurs de signer des documents sans quitter votre application.
- REST API complète avec authentification, limitation de débit et mode sandbox
- Server SDK pour Node.js et Embed SDK pour les frontends web
- Webhooks pour les notifications d'événements en temps réel
- Environnement sandbox où vous pouvez tester sans affecter la production
Collaboration en équipe
Vous pouvez inviter des membres de l'équipe avec un accès basé sur les rôles : Propriétaire, Administrateur, Membre ou Observateur. Chaque rôle contrôle ce qu'une personne peut voir, modifier et signer. Les journaux d'activité tracent tout, ce qui est crucial lorsque vous devez prouver qui a approuvé quoi.
Pour les équipes nécessitant une vérification d'identité, Chaindoc s'intègre avec Sumsub pour les contrôles KYC. Consultez la page de gestion d'équipe pour les détails de configuration.
Comment fonctionne le processus de signature
Le flux typique du téléchargement au document signé comprend six étapes. La majeure partie est automatisée une fois que vous avez configuré la demande.
1Téléchargez votre documentTéléchargez un fichier PDF, Office, image ou vidéo via l'interface web ou l'API. Le fichier est stocké et se voit attribuer un identifiant unique.
2Créez une demande de signatureAjoutez des destinataires, définissez un ordre de signature (séquentiel ou parallèle), choisissez une échéance et rédigez un message personnalisé si vous le souhaitez. Cela prend environ 30 secondes dans l'interface.
3Les signataires sont notifiésLes destinataires reçoivent un email avec un lien de signature sécurisé. Si vous utilisez l'Embed SDK, ils verront l'interface de signature directement dans votre application.
4Les signataires révisent et signentChaque signataire s'authentifie via OTP, examine le document et applique sa signature électronique. L'ensemble du processus prend moins d'une minute pour la plupart des documents.
5Vérification blockchainUne fois que toutes les parties ont signé, le hash du document est écrit sur la blockchain automatiquement. Cela crée une preuve immuable de l'état du document au moment de la signature.
6Tout le monde reçoit la copie signéeToutes les parties reçoivent le document final avec un certificat de vérification blockchain joint. Vous pouvez vérifier l'authenticité à tout moment en utilisant le certificat.
Cas d'usage courants
Chaindoc fonctionne dans tous les secteurs, mais voici où les équipes en retirent le plus de valeur :
- Juridique et conformité — contrats, NDAs, accords de travail. L'historique d'audit blockchain satisfait la plupart des exigences réglementaires sans paperasse supplémentaire.
- Immobilier — accords de propriété et baux où vous avez besoin d'un enregistrement immuable qui tient en cas de litige.
- Services financiers — accords de prêt, documents d'investissement et formulaires de conformité qui doivent répondre aux normes réglementaires.
- Santé — formulaires de consentement des patients et dossiers médicaux avec gestion documentaire conforme HIPAA.
- Entreprise — approbations internes, documents RH, accords fournisseurs. Les équipes traitant des centaines de contrats par mois économisent le plus de temps en automatisant avec l'API.
Vue d'ensemble de l'architecture
Chaindoc combine une infrastructure cloud standard avec une couche blockchain. Vous n'avez pas besoin de comprendre l'ensemble de la stack pour utiliser l'API, mais il est utile de savoir ce qui tourne sous le capot :
- Application web construite avec React et Next.js
- REST API Node.js avec authentification, limitation de débit et versioning
- PostgreSQL pour les données structurées, S3 pour le stockage de fichiers
- Smart contracts sur Ethereum, Polygon, BSC et Arbitrum pour la vérification des documents
- File de messages orientée événements qui alimente les webhooks et notifications
- CDN global pour une livraison rapide des documents
Sécurité et conformité
La sécurité n'est pas une option ici. Elle est intégrée dans la façon dont les documents sont stockés, transmis et vérifiés.
Si vous traitez des documents sensibles, consultez le guide des bonnes pratiques de sécurité pour des recommandations sur le contrôle d'accès, les paramètres de chiffrement et les configurations de conformité.
Par où continuer
Choisissez le chemin qui correspond à ce que vous essayez de faire :
- Démarrage rapide — envoyez votre premier document à signer en moins de 10 minutes
- Installation — configurez les SDKs dans votre environnement de développement
- Documentation API — référence complète de la REST API avec exemples
- SDKs — Node.js Server SDK et Embed SDK pour les applications web